I present to you this video of a wonderful cover of the song "Superstar" performed by New York noisecore band Sonic Youth. She was listed as number 94 of the best all time singers in a 2010 ranking. Karen beat out John Bonham in a 1975 Playboy readers poll of best drummers. She felt most comfortable on stage behind her Ludwig drum kit. She was praised by Hal Blaine and Buddy Rich for her drumming. Artists such as Madonna, Sheryl Crow, Natalie Imbruglia, Shania Twain, Pat Metheny, Elton John, and Sonic Youth's Kim Gordon. A list of musicians who were influenced or admired Karen is lengthy. The legacy left behind by Karen and her brother is immense. The Carpenters had a 14 year career which saw the brother sister duo record 10 albums, have several successful singles, as well as have a few TV specials. Her three octave contralto voice is unmistakable. ![]() However she certainly made her mark on American pop music in the 1970's.
